- Western blot in-vitro kinase assay using purifed active ERK2, wild-type (WT) PKM2 and PKM2 S37A mutant. Detection was performed using PKM2 (pSer37) polyclonal antibody (Product # PA5-37684).

- Fig. 4 Cdc25A dephosphorylated PKM2 to suppress sorafenib-induced ferroptosis. A Relative p-PKM2 Ser37 levels in the nucleus and cytosol of transfected cells following sorafenib treatment. B Co-IP was used to analyse the interaction of Cdc25A and PKM2 in the nucleus and cytosol. C Relative p-PKM2 Ser37 levels in transfected cells with or without sorafenib treatment. D The MTT assay to analyse the viability of transfected cells following sorafenib treatment. E Cellular MDA levels in transfected cells after sorafenib treatment. F Cellular ROS levels in transfected cells after sorafenib treatment. G Cellular GSH levels in transfected cells after sorafenib treatment. H Cellular iron levels in transfected cells after sorafenib treatment. Each experiment was repeated three times. * P < 0.05; ** P < 0.01; *** P < 0.001.
